UNSW invites applications for a Postdoctoral Fellow in Perovskite Photovoltaic Materials.
The role focuses on designing, synthesising and characterising novel functional materials for perovskite PV applications and contributing to high-performance devices.
You will disseminate outcomes, participate in conferences, and assist with supervising research students.
The position is based at Kensington, Sydney, under Prof Xiaojing Hao, with a fixed-term contract of 1 year (potential extension).
